Might be useful, looks somewhat down the road, just pull the Time slider and everything glides around moves over fbm modulation.

Now, this is a characteristic simplex modulation, where both compressed bands and plamages is a theme, you can pipe the shader through a Color Correction node and work on hue/saturation if you want to tweak hardcoded color set.

You could also try adding noise->rampRGB->specular_color or just use your texture map-> specular_color.
